apparent discrepancy between amount charged per hour and amount actually received
I was looking through other user profiles, trying to find a good hourly rate based on providers with similar skills to mine. I came across one who charges $22.22 per hour. Under his "Recent Work History and Feedback," I noticed that he is working on a job in progress and has earned $167 so far for working for "43 hours @ $3.89." Are there any possible explanations for this massive discrepancy between his posted hourly rate and paid hourly rate? Is oDesk, or any other entity that oDesk is affiliated with, receiving any income from this provider's paid hourly rate that is causing this extremely low pay rate?

The $22.22 per hour is provider's posted rate in the yellow right hand portion of the profile, correct? If so, that's filled in by the provider, or the affiliated contractor's staffing manager. It is not calculated based on the actual rate earned. Actual assignments could be at a higher or lower rate. The buyer is this case is paying 3.89/hour. For full disclosure, oDesk keeps 10% of the assignment rates you see on provider profiles.
You have the opportunity to enter a rate (to which oDesk adds their fee) every time you apply to a job - it doesn't have to be the same as your posted profile rate. But most people do apply at (or at least very near) their profile rate.
Personally, I have a satisfactory workload, so I keep my profile rate set at the level I would need to take on a new job.
